A Minor Surgery LED Shadowless Lamp is an essential piece of medical equipment designed specifically for minor surgical procedures. It utilizes advanced LED technology to emit bright, uniform light, effectively eliminating shadows in the surgical field. This is crucial because shadows can obscure important anatomical details, potentially leading to errors during surgery. The design of the lamp ensures that the light is evenly distributed, providing surgeons with clear visibility of the area they are working on. Moreover, LED lights are energy - efficient, long - lasting, and generate less heat compared to traditional lighting sources. This not only reduces energy consumption in the healthcare facility but also minimizes the risk of thermal damage to the patient's tissue. Overall, the Minor Surgery LED Shadowless Lamp significantly enhances the precision and safety of minor surgical operations, contributing to better surgical outcomes and patient care.
The Minor Surgery LED Shadowless Lamp market has been witnessing significant developments in recent times. In terms of market size, it is projected to experience substantial growth. This growth can be attributed to several factors. One of the primary drivers is the increasing number of surgical procedures globally. The World Health Organization reported that more than 350 million surgical procedures were conducted worldwide, creating a strong demand for high - quality lighting equipment such as LED shadowless lamps for minor surgeries.
When considering major sales regions, Asia - Pacific is likely to be a dominant market. The large number of hospitals in countries like India and China, along with the growing frequency of surgical interventions, is fueling the demand for these lamps. The region's expanding healthcare infrastructure and rising disposable income are also contributing factors. Europe holds the next - largest market share. The increasing adoption of LED lights in this area, driven by technological advancements and a focus on energy - efficient and high - performance medical equipment, is driving the market growth. North America is also expected to gain significant traction, mainly due to the development in specialist clinics in the United States and Canada. However, in regions such as Latin America, the Middle East, and Africa, the market growth is predicted to be slower. A shortage of funds among hospitals in these regions to purchase expensive surgical equipment, including LED shadowless lamps, is a major hindrance.
The market also presents several opportunities and challenges. Opportunities include the continuous technological advancements in LED lighting technology. As LED lights consume less electricity and provide brighter illumination compared to traditional lighting sources, there is a growing preference for them in minor surgical procedures. Additionally, the increasing awareness about the importance of proper lighting during surgeries for better surgical outcomes and patient safety is opening up new market opportunities. However, challenges exist as well. Product recalls due to faulty lamps, as seen in cases like the FDA recall of the Volista standop surgical light by Maquet SAS firm in 2018, can negatively impact the market. Such recalls can lead to loss of consumer confidence and potential financial losses for manufacturers.
Looking at future product trends, we can expect to see further improvements in energy efficiency, light quality, and portability. Manufacturers will likely focus on developing lamps with even lower power consumption without compromising on illumination levels. There will also be an emphasis on enhancing the shadow - less effect to provide surgeons with an even clearer view of the surgical field. Additionally, more integrated features such as cameras or connectivity options may be added to these lamps, enabling better documentation and communication during surgeries. For instance, some companies may develop LED shadowless lamps with built - in cameras that can stream live video of the surgical procedure, which could be useful for training purposes or for remote consultations.
